Design and test results for small-signal multifunction MMICs (monolithic microwave integrated circuits) for C-band transmit/receive (T/R) modules are presented. This chip set includes the entire receive path and a portion of the transmit path (seven stages of amplification and 11 passive circuits) in just four chips. These ICs, fabricated with the multifunction self-aligned gate (MSAG) process, demonstrate a high level of integration, excellent performance, and a good yield.
